    #1 - King of the Hill

    S2:E2

    The latest in a series of armed robberies on super-markets leaves a young cashier possibly paralysed when the thieves take her hostage and then push her from their speeding car to slow up the pursuing cops. The cars used by the robbers are specially modified "hill racers", leading to the local hill racing champion, an old friend of Hooker's, being wrongly arrested as the prime suspect. Hooker must prove his innocence by speeding after the real culprits...

    #2 - Lady in Blue

    S2:E22

    Hooker holds himself personally to blame when a female rookie cop that he trained is seriously wounded in a confrontation with a pair of fleeing gun-shop robbers. With the officer needing her leg amputated as a result of the wound, Hooker and Romano, with help from Stacy and Corrigan, investigate the gun thieves, who are selling their hauls to a back-street crime baron...

    #4 - Chinatown

    S3:E3

    Responding to a shooting at a cock-fight in China Town, Hooker thinks he catches a glimpse of a face from the past in the crowd. As he investigates the illegal dealing of automatic weapons in the area, the face turns out to be the daughter of a woman who he was once in love with, but had to cut off their relationship after her husband, presumed dead, had turned up alive. But now, the man is involved with the gun dealing, and sees that he has an old score to settle with Hooker...

    #11 - Hardcore Connection

    S4:E4

    While on a prostitution sting, Hooker spots veteran vice officer Daniels' car parked outside a motel, and goes to investigate just as the officer is shot by an assassin. Both the gun-man and the prostitute Daniels was meeting with flee the scene, and the officer's superior reports that Daniels wasn't there on Police business, and what's more, was found with money suggesting that he'd been taking bribes. But Hooker is adamant that the veteran officer is innocent of the accusations, and has two days before the funeral to clear the officer's name and find out what he was really doing at the motel. The girl Daniels was meeting with holds the key to the true circumstances, and Hooker forces her ex-roommate, a reluctant, wise-cracking ex-prostitute, into helping him track the down. But the girl is hiding in fear from the dangerous porno producer who was involved with the officer's shooting...

"King of the Hill" is the best rated episode of "T. J. Hooker". It scored 10/10 based on 1 votes. Directed by Charlie Picerni and written by Stephen Downing, it aired on 10/2/1982. This episode scored 0.0 points higher than the second highest rated, "Lady in Blue".
